Taxonomy Code 374J00000X
Display Name Doula
Taxonomy Group Nursing Service Related Providers
Taxonomy Classification Doula
Definition Doulas work in a variety of settings and have been trained to provide physical, emotional, and informational support to a mother before, during, and just after birth and/or provide emotional and practical support to a mother during the postpartum period.
Effective Date September 30, 2009
